1. Understanding Different Types of Casual Shirts
Before styling, it’s important to know the different types of casual shirts available:
- Oxford and Button-Down Shirts: Structured and versatile, suitable for casual and smart-casual looks.
- Chambray or Denim Shirts: Casual and rugged, perfect for everyday wear.
- Linen Shirts: Lightweight and breathable, ideal for summer and travel.
- Flannel Shirts: Soft and warm, great for cooler weather.
- Short-Sleeve and Camp Collar Shirts: Relaxed styles best suited for casual outings.
2. Getting the Perfect Fit
Fit plays a major role in how your casual shirt looks. A well-fitted shirt enhances your body shape and makes even simple outfits look polished.
- Shoulder seams should align with your shoulders.
- The shirt should lightly taper at the waist without feeling tight.
- Sleeves should end at the wrist bone for long-sleeve shirts.
- You should be able to move comfortably without excess fabric.
3. Choosing the Right Fabric
Fabric selection depends on the season and the occasion:
- Cotton: Ideal for everyday wear and office casual looks.
- Linen: Best for warm climates and summer outfits.
- Brushed Cotton or Flannel: Suitable for colder months.
- Cotton Blends: Offer durability and easy maintenance.
4. Color and Pattern Selection
Neutral colors like white, navy, grey, olive, and light blue are easy to style and work for most occasions. If you want to experiment, add subtle patterns such as stripes, checks, or small prints.
Pair bold shirts with neutral trousers to keep the outfit balanced.
5. Styling Casual Shirts for Different Occasions
Casual Weekend Look
Pair an untucked chambray or oxford shirt with jeans or chinos and sneakers. This look is comfortable yet stylish for everyday activities.
Office or Smart Casual
Choose a plain cotton shirt, tuck it into tailored chinos, and finish the look with loafers or smart sneakers. Add a lightweight blazer for extra polish.
Date Night Outfit
Opt for a fitted shirt in darker shades such as navy, maroon, or charcoal. Pair it with slim-fit trousers and leather shoes for a confident and attractive look.
Travel and Vacation
Linen shirts layered over a basic t-shirt work well for travel. Combine them with relaxed-fit trousers and comfortable footwear.
Summer and Beach Wear
Short-sleeve shirts or camp-collar styles worn with shorts and canvas shoes create an effortless summer outfit.
6. Tucking, Rolling, and Layering
Tuck your shirt for formal or smart-casual occasions and leave it untucked for relaxed settings. Rolling up sleeves adds a casual touch, while layering with jackets or sweaters creates depth.
